I liked Ridley Scott's comments on "The Duellists" (his first feature). How he got rid of his DOP, operating much of the film himself, mistakes etc.
Very true, it is boring to the extreme to hear everyone praising everyone and everything on a film, especially if you know how awful the atmosphere between them often is during the filming. That's why directors' comments on older films often are (a bit) more honest: the film doesn't need desperate promoting anymore. |
